Fiber optic cable testing tools are essential for verifying network performance, detecting faults, and ensuring signal integrity in both single-mode and multimode fiber networks.

Key Fiber Optic Testing Tools

1. Optical Loss Test Sets (OLTS) OLTS are used to measure insertion loss and optical power levels across fiber links, simulating real network conditions. They help verify that a fiber can support the intended application and ensure compliance with industry standards such as TIA/EIA . 2. Optical Time-Domain Reflectometers (OTDR) OTDRs send pulses of light through the fiber and analyze reflections to detect splices, bends, breaks, and attenuation points. They provide a graphical map of the fiber, making them ideal for troubleshooting and certifying new installations . 3. Visual Fault Locators (VFL) VFLs use visible light to quickly identify breaks, severe bends, or faulty connectors. They are particularly useful for quick fault detection during installation or maintenance . 4. Power Meters and Light Sources These tools measure signal attenuation and verify that the fiber link meets required power levels. The one-jumper method, using a power meter and light source, is highly accurate for measuring signal loss across connectors and splices . 5. Fiber Inspection Microscopes Microscopes, such as the FI-7000 FiberInspector Pro, allow technicians to examine fiber end faces for contamination or damage. Automated Pass/Fail certification ensures consistent quality control and reduces human error . 6. MPO Fiber Testing Kits Tools like the MultiFiber Pro can certify multiple fibers simultaneously, reducing test time and complexity. They are essential for high-density fiber applications and ensure correct polarity and minimal insertion loss .

Additional Considerations

  • Cleaning Tools: Contamination is a leading cause of fiber network failure. Proper cleaning tools maintain optimal connector performance and reduce troubleshooting time .
  • Single-mode vs. Multimode Testing: Some tools, like SimpliFiber Pro, support both single-mode and multimode fibers, allowing measurement of power and loss at multiple wavelengths .
  • Documentation and Storage: Modern testers often include built-in results storage and mobile app integration for reporting and compliance verification .

Summary

Fiber optic testing tools are critical for installation, maintenance, and troubleshooting in communication engineering. Using a combination of OLTS, OTDR, VFL, power meters, and inspection microscopes ensures accurate measurement of insertion loss, return loss, and fault detection, while cleaning and MPO testing tools maintain network reliability and efficiency. Proper selection and use of these tools are essential for high-speed, long-distance, and interference-free fiber optic communication networks .
